Lúcio’s Confession is a decadent novella written by Mário de Sá-Carneiro. It tells the story of a triangle – Lúcio, Marta and Ricardo. It is a story of love, obsession, madness and suicide. A fantastic, sexual and abnormal crime. Lúcio becomes close to Ricardo, who is married to Marta, who becomes close to Lúcio. Ricardo is Lúcio in the author’s projection. And Marta will be the bridge between them. But is she real? And who dies in the end?
An unusual incursion into the human mind, between the Lisbon of the literary cafés and the bohemian Paris. The treatment that this story makes of such themes as gender, sexuality and art is still highly relevant today. – André Murraças
